Honest question: if you're using multiple agents, it's usually to produce not a dozen lines of code. It's to produce a big enough feature spanning multiple files, modules and entry points, with tests and all. So far so good. But once that feature is written by the agents... wouldn't you review it? Like reading line by line what's going on and detecting if something is off? And wouldn't that part, the manual reviewing, take an enormous amount of time compare to the time it took the agents to produce it? (you know, it's more difficult to read other people's/machine code than to write it yourself)... meaning all the productivity gained is thrown out the door.

Unless you don't review every generated line manually, and instead rely on, let's say, UI e2e testing, or perhaps unit testing (that the agents also wrote). I don't know, perhaps we are past the phase of "double check what agents write" and are now in the phase of "ship it. if it breaks, let agents fix it, no manual debugging needed!" ?

> The worktree system removed the friction of context-switching - juggling multiple streams of work without them colliding. I'm so conflicted about this. On the one hand I love the buzz of feeling so productive and working on many different threads. On the other hand my brain gets so fried, and I think this is a big contributor.

Is constant juggling of multiple agents productive? I haven't seen the allure (except maybe with 2 agents sometimes). I guess it depends on what kind of tasks one is doing and I can imagine it working if doing large, long-running tasks, but then reviewing those large changes and refactoring becomes more difficult. And if you're juggling multiple agents, there's the mental context switching and tooling overhead for managing them. Maybe predictable and repetitive tasks can work well.

I prefer focusing mostly on 1 task at a time (sometimes 2 for a short time, or asking other agent some questions simultaneously) and doing the task in chunks so it doesn't take much time until you have something to review. Then I review it, maybe ask for some refactoring and let it continue to the next step (maybe let it continue a bit before finishing review if feeling confident about the code). It's easier to review smaller self-contained chunks and easier to refer to code and tell AI what needs changing because of fewer amount of relevant lines.

Yeah I agree.

We have “Cursor Bot” enabled at work. It reviews our PRs (in addition to a human review)

One thing it does is add a PR summary to the PR description. It’s kind of helpful since it outlines a clear list of what changed in code. But it would be very lacking if it was the full PR description. It doesn’t include anything about _why_ the changes were made, what else was tried, what is coming next, etc.

Lines of code are meaningful when taken in aggregate and useless as a metric for an individual’s contributions.

COCOMO, which considers lines of code, is generally accepted as being accurate (enough) at estimating the value of a software system, at least as far as how courts (in the US) are concerned.
